Product Description Features: The octagonal restrictor gate is the perfect addition to any fighting game fan's joystick.

This restrictor gate will give you more precise 8-way movement for fighting games, such as Street Fighter. Compatible for Sanwa JLF series joysticks: JLF-TP-8YT(-SK) JLF-TP-8Y(-SK) JLF-TP-8S(-SK) JLF-TM-8(-SK) JLX Material: Plastic Size: 49 x 49mm
